Restaurantji launches commission-free reservations for independent restaurants

Restaurantji has launched Restaurantji Reservations, a flat-fee booking platform for independent restaurants and local groups starting at $35 per month. The product is designed to cut per-booking costs, reduce no-shows and give operators a direct booking link across websites, social media and Restaurantji listings.

Why it matters: - Independent restaurants often lose margin to reservation fees that rise as bookings increase. - Restaurantji Reservations gives operators a flat monthly price instead of per-cover or per-booking commissions. - The platform is aimed at helping restaurants capture more direct bookings from channels they already use.

What happened: - Restaurantji launched Restaurantji Reservations on Aug. 6, 2026. - The platform is built for independent restaurants and local restaurant groups. - Pricing starts at $35 per month. - Restaurantji says the product eliminates traditional per-cover and per-booking fees.

The details: - Restaurantji says the dining discovery platform reaches more than 2 million monthly visitors. - Restaurants get a single direct booking link for websites, Instagram, Facebook, email campaigns, SMS, QR codes, local ads and Restaurantji listings. - A real-time dashboard combines reservations, a live floor view, waitlist management, walk-in tracking and table status updates. - The system includes automated SMS confirmations. - The platform can send post-visit review requests. - Operators can add deposits or prepayments. - Restaurant owners can use marketing analytics to track which channels drive booked tables. - Setup takes about 30 minutes. - Every plan includes a 14-day free trial. - Restaurants can start with core reservation tools and later add POS integration, menu management, payments and detailed analytics. - Participating restaurants receive elevated visibility on Restaurantji listings.

Between the lines: - The launch positions Restaurantji against reservation tools that charge based on guest volume. - Elijah Puzhakov, Chief Communications Officer at Restaurantji, said predictable pricing is meant to help independent operators keep more revenue as they grow. - The added discovery placement suggests Restaurantji is pairing booking software with traffic generation to make the product more attractive.

What's next: - Restaurants interested in the platform can start a 14-day free trial at Restaurantji's restaurant platform page. - Restaurantji says operators can expand into more advanced tools as their needs grow. - The company also continues to promote its broader directory, which it says includes detailed information on more than 1 million restaurants across the U.S. and Canada.

The bottom line: - Restaurantji is betting that flat-rate pricing, direct booking links and discovery exposure will appeal to independent restaurants trying to cut reservation costs and keep more control over guest bookings.
